Community Emergency Response Team

CERT (Community Emergency Response Team) volunteers are a group of community members who are ready respond as an auxiliary to the fire department in the event of a major disaster. CERT team members:

  • Receive 20 hours of training delivered over 4 weekend days.
  • Learn techniques in the areas of: first aid, light search and rescue, fire extinguisher use, medical triage, emergency communication and more.
  • Participate in periodic drills/exercises on a volunteer-friendly schedule.
  • Learn how to remain safe while helping others.
  • Assist Fire and other Emergency response personnel in the event of a large-scale disaster.
